Palolem and its surrounding areas in south Goa hold a special place in my heart – it’s where my life in India began. The heart-shaped beach skirted by swaying palms is now dotted with little beach huts where tons of Europeans enjoy a well-deserved winter vacation away from the cold.Â
However, the place has largely remained a sleepy coastal village over the monsoon, with the huts closing up as the rains come around. But over the last eight months, there has been a lot of curiosity around this upcoming hotel. When it finally opened doors, I was absolutely delighted to visit Sobit Sarovar Portico in all its glory.
Managed by Sarovar Hotels and Resorts, the property hit the ground running with impeccable service, friendly local staff and absolutely delicious food. Located right by the road, it offers easy access, and once inside, the gorgeous poolside area simply takes your breath away. Every room faces the pool, so there’s no way you’ll miss out on the hotel’s piece-de-resistance as you spend your days lazing about.
Still, there’s so much more to the hotel. Its bar Uzo is well-stocked with a large array of international beverages styled in a chic, friendly manner. Flavours is Sobit Sarovar Portico’s multi-cuisine restaurant with popular dishes from around the world, served with flair. At Balcão, guests can lounge by the pool as they sip innovative cocktails and nibble on delicious snacks.
The live counters at Flavours were an immediate hit, adding an additional facet to the restaurant’s all-day services and buffet spread from around India and the Mediterranean. My favourites included the chicken satay in peanut sauce and Goan special prawn rawa fry. The extensive menu has tons on offer, right from stir-fried noodles and biryani, to Thai green curry and classic Goan fish curry, and other Indian gravies. With aims to promote tourism in the area and offer high-quality service and a great alternative to currently available accommodation, this hotel has opened up more comfortable options of staying in and around the south. Spread across 5500 square metres, Sobit Sarovar Portico has 48 well-appointed deluxe rooms encased beautifully by quaint architecture that reflects Goa’s history and culture. Intricate woodwork, hand-selected art and sleek lines showcase a blend of Goan and Indo-Portuguese styles. Throughout the hotel, paintings by Pravin Solanke and other art narrate the tale of Goa’s heritage, culture, landscapes, events and daily life. With its gorgeous interiors, Sala de Cristal banquet hall offers the ideal venue for events of any sort, from weddings to private parties, exhibitions to corporate retreats for up to 350 guests. To reinforce that feeling of relaxation, Sobit Sarovar Portico offers O Spa, at which trained therapists ease and relax guests with a wide variety of treatments. In addition, the resort has a well-equipped gym, activity center for children and adults, and complimentary Wi-Fi.Â
